Is Carrefour Cajun Chicken Fillet Safe? Ingredient Analysis
Carrefour
This page reviews Carrefour Cajun Chicken Fillet by Carrefour as a meat product. Its current score is 60/100, suggesting that it looks generally acceptable but still includes some ingredients worth reviewing.
If you want the short version, start with these flagged ingredients: Glucose Syrup, E331iii, E500i.
60 / 100
Why score is 60
The composition includes 90% chicken meat and a marinade with several additives. The presence of stabilizers E331iii and E500i raises concerns about processed ingredients, impacting the overall rating.
Main concern
Contains stabilizers E331iii and E500i, which are processed additives that may raise quality concerns.

Pros
- High chicken meat content (90%) indicates a substantial protein source.
- Includes spices like smoked paprika and garlic powder, enhancing flavor naturally.
Concerns
- Contains stabilizers E331iii and E500i, which are processed additives that may raise quality concerns.
- Glucose syrup is present, which is a processed ingredient that can be a concern for some consumers.
